Decoction for Moistening the Lungs, Resolving Phlegm, and Calming Cough

Decoction for Moistening the Lungs, Resolving Phlegm, and Calming Cough,For cough.

Formulas Name : Decoction for Moistening the Lungs, Resolving Phlegm, and Calming Cough

Chinese Name : 润肺豁痰宁嗽汤

Drug Formulation

5 fen of tangerine peel, 5 fen of pinellia (processed with ginger), 4 fen of white poria, 3 fen of licorice (roasted), 5 fen of phellodendron (stir-fried with wine), 3 fen of scutellaria (washed with wine), 5 fen of anemarrhena (stir-fried with wine), 5 fen of fritillary bulb (core removed), 3 fen of asparagus root (core removed), 3 fen of ophiopogon tuber (core removed),Aster tataricus (washed with wine) 0.03 grams, Tussilago farfara (washed with wine) 0.03 grams, Platycodon grandiflorus 0.03 grams, Rehmannia glutinosa (prepared) 0.05 grams, Angelica sinensis 0.03 grams.

Source

*Gujin Yijian* (A Mirror of Medicine Through the Ages), Volume 4.

Processing

Grind the above ingredients into one dose.

Benefits

For cough.

Instructions for Use

Add 1 slice of fresh ginger, decoct in water, and take while warm.
